In a message dated 7/6/0 10:53:16 PM, [log in to unmask] writes:

<< A mom called me because she was asked to leave McDonald's (!!!!) because
she
was breastfeeding.  She lives in Northern California.
She would like to talk to an attorney.  Any ideas?
 >>

Wow, this is becoming a little epidemic. I got a call from a friend who is
also an LLLL last night looking for a printed copy of CT's law protecting a
woman's right to bf in public. She was verbally harassed (I mean w/ yelling
and swearing by a shop owner) b/c she refused to stop nursing or leave the
store. She remained very calm (as is her nature, fortunately), and waited
patiently for the police who the shop-owner called to have her thrown out.
They never came, so she left. Today she went to the police station and found
out that the shop owner had been told by the dispatcher (whose Sgt. looked up
the law) that he was in the wrong, which is why they never came. She is
filing a complaint with the Commission on Human Rights and wouldn't you know
it, her mother just happens to work at a law firm. We'll see what happens
next.
